reinforcing fibers and thier properties

effect of fiber volume

by increasing fiber volume representwdby fiber diameter thestrength will decrease

fiber classification

naturalfiber
chemical fiber(synthetic fiber)


syntethic fiber : organic fiber ,anorganic fiber

anorganic

glass fibers

organic fiber

aramide fiber
carbon fibers

influence of fiber

deacrese : deformability, sliding properties , tendency to creep , thermal expansion

increase : notch sensivity,thermal deformation resistance , stiffness and strength, anisotropy,warpage

fiberglass

most used reinforcing fiber
3d cross linking with covalant bond

amorphous structure

isotropic properties


originally developed for electrical application.

oxygen,silicon,aluminum,boron,sodum

*fiber forming through melt spinning

properties of glass fiber

no viscos behavior
no flammable

resistant to organic and inorganicacid

isotropic properties

relativelycheap

permeable to radar emission

ad & disad fiber glass

dis :low youngmodulus, aging through water contact,brittle,sensitive to basic enviroment

dis:

good adhesion toresin,low thermal expansion,low electrical conductivity,low cost,good dielectric properties

fiber glass type

R,S,R
E: mostly sio2 with ca/mg/Al/B-oxide

good electrical properties

most commenly used glass fiber


S : more Alinumoxide,higj strengyh stiffness at low density,used in aerospace, more expensive than E glass


R : with calciumoxide, higher stiffnes but higher density,used for specialapplication
